summaryrefslogtreecommitdiff
path: root/deps/v8/test/mjsunit/regress/wasm/regress-854011.js
diff options
context:
space:
mode:
Diffstat (limited to 'deps/v8/test/mjsunit/regress/wasm/regress-854011.js')
-rw-r--r--deps/v8/test/mjsunit/regress/wasm/regress-854011.js18
1 files changed, 9 insertions, 9 deletions
diff --git a/deps/v8/test/mjsunit/regress/wasm/regress-854011.js b/deps/v8/test/mjsunit/regress/wasm/regress-854011.js
index b0356a873f..00cfe655cb 100644
--- a/deps/v8/test/mjsunit/regress/wasm/regress-854011.js
+++ b/deps/v8/test/mjsunit/regress/wasm/regress-854011.js
@@ -9,14 +9,14 @@ builder.addFunction('main', kSig_d_d)
.addBody([
// Call with param 0 (converted to i64), to fill the stack with non-zero
// values.
- kExprGetLocal, 0, kExprI64SConvertF64, // arg 0
- kExprGetLocal, 0, kExprI64SConvertF64, // arg 1
- kExprGetLocal, 0, kExprI64SConvertF64, // arg 2
- kExprGetLocal, 0, kExprI64SConvertF64, // arg 3
- kExprGetLocal, 0, kExprI64SConvertF64, // arg 4
- kExprGetLocal, 0, kExprI64SConvertF64, // arg 5
- kExprGetLocal, 0, kExprI64SConvertF64, // arg 6
- kExprGetLocal, 0, kExprI64SConvertF64, // arg 7
+ kExprLocalGet, 0, kExprI64SConvertF64, // arg 0
+ kExprLocalGet, 0, kExprI64SConvertF64, // arg 1
+ kExprLocalGet, 0, kExprI64SConvertF64, // arg 2
+ kExprLocalGet, 0, kExprI64SConvertF64, // arg 3
+ kExprLocalGet, 0, kExprI64SConvertF64, // arg 4
+ kExprLocalGet, 0, kExprI64SConvertF64, // arg 5
+ kExprLocalGet, 0, kExprI64SConvertF64, // arg 6
+ kExprLocalGet, 0, kExprI64SConvertF64, // arg 7
kExprCallFunction, 1, // call #1
// Now call with 0 constants.
// The bug was that they were written out as i32 values, thus the upper 32
@@ -36,7 +36,7 @@ builder.addFunction('main', kSig_d_d)
.exportFunc();
builder.addFunction(undefined, makeSig(new Array(8).fill(kWasmI64), [kWasmF64]))
.addBody([
- kExprGetLocal, 7, // get_local 7 (last parameter)
+ kExprLocalGet, 7, // get_local 7 (last parameter)
kExprF64SConvertI64, // f64.convert_s/i64
]);
const instance = builder.instantiate();